Output 5892a96b841e719e244a646f1071fbf8b5867ac5cf507bd9ae6c48a542d9f52d:0

value
2665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a70e66d1a2431868c59b8b8fdfafb526c62d73 OP_EQUAL
address
3B3nyP9THTyPC6JRWjz77hcuWUugbyMfnH
transaction
5892a96b841e719e244a646f1071fbf8b5867ac5cf507bd9ae6c48a542d9f52d
spent
true